About F. Moretti
F. Moretti is a scholar working on Aerospace Engineering, Materials Chemistry, Computational Mechanics, Mechanical Engineering and Biomedical Engineering, having authored 35 papers that have together received 349 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Nuclear Engineering Thermal-Hydraulics (26 papers), Nuclear reactor physics and engineering (23 papers), Nuclear Materials and Properties (14 papers), Heat Transfer and Boiling Studies (4 papers), Fluid Dynamics and Mixing (3 papers), Combustion and Detonation Processes (3 papers), Fluid Dynamics and Heat Transfer (2 papers) and Heat transfer and supercritical fluids (2 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Aerospace Engineering (289 citations), Computational Mechanics (133 citations), Statistics, Probability and Uncertainty (31 citations), Safety, Risk, Reliability and Quality (30 citations) and Materials Chemistry (122 citations). F. Moretti has collaborated with scholars based in Italy, Germany and France. Frequent co-authors include Francesco Saverio D'Auria, Brian L. Smith, Ulrich L. Rohde, M. Scheuerer, Chul-Hwa Song, J.H. Mahaffy, M. Heitsch, Mats Henriksson, Tadashi Watanabe and Frédéric Dubois. Their work appears in journals such as Nuclear Engineering and Design, Science and Technology of Nuclear Installations, Nuclear Technology and Radiation Protection, World Journal of Nuclear Science and Technology and Journal of Power and Energy Systems.
